Ford Edge owners have reported 2,505 electrical system related problems since 1996. Table 1 shows the 38 most common electrical system problems. The number one most common problem is related to the vehicle's electrical system (2,291 problems). The second most common problem is related to the vehicle's battery dead (49 problems).
